Analysis Notes
Forecast Listed as the incumbent award in contract forecast MISSION SYSTEMS LIFECYCLE SUPPORT (MSLS).
Amendment Since initial award the Potential End Date has been extended from 07/23/25 to 10/31/25 and the Potential Award value has increased 28% from $64,325,558 to $82,465,528.
Subcontracting Plan This Delivery Order has an Individual Subcontract Plan. The Department of Homeland Security has an overall small business subcontracting goal of 43%
Undisclosed Subcontractors No subcontract awards have been formally disclosed for this contract; however, based on invoice data these subcontractors have worked on this contract: TTW Solutions, Epic Systems, DEV Technology Group, Athena Sciences, SNA International, Five 9 Group, Linkware, Epic Systems, Athena Sciences Corporation, Mount Airey Group

General Dynamics Information Technology was awarded
Delivery Order 70RCSA20FR0000078 (70RCSA-20-F-R0000078)
worth up to $82,465,528
by the Immediate Office of the Under Secretary for Management
in September 2020.
The contract
has a duration of 5 years 1 months and
was awarded
through solicitation 70RCSA20Q00000101
full & open
with
NAICS 541512 and
PSC D318
via subject to multiple award fair opportunity acquisition procedures with 6 bids received.
As of today, the Delivery Order has a total reported backlog of $1,941,689 and funded backlog of $1,941,689.
This contract was awarded through vehicle Alliant II (Unrestricted).
